A factory that is due to close next year with the loss of 200 jobs so the management can move its work to eastern Europe is currently so busy that temporary staff are being taken on to cope.
Carron Phoenix (
www.carron.com), which is owned by the Franke Group, is to close its Falkirk sink-making plant by December 2017 and move operations to Slovakia to reduce costs.
The leader of Falkirk Council, Craig Martin (pictured), says that a taskforce has been set up to explore a “package” that could persuade the firm to re-locate elsewhere in Falkirk.
“The company’s representatives we met with have assured us that they will take our proposals to their board. I believe there hasn’t been a brick laid in Slovakia as yet, and it could take six months for them get the planning permissions they need, so we have that time to find a package that can keep these jobs here.”
